Before you even set foot in the parks, Ryan recommends purchasing your tickets in advance. This may seem like a no-brainer, but it can save you both time and money in the long run. By taking advantage of discounts and purchasing a two-week ticket, UK travelers can save a significant amount compared to buying their tickets on arrival in Orlando.

Once you have your tickets, it's time to start planning your itinerary. Ryan suggests mapping out which parks you'll be visiting each day, and then following his top tips to make sure you don't overspend. After all, not all of us have Scrooge McDuck's fortune to splurge on our Disney adventures.

First and foremost, Ryan stresses the importance of setting a budget and sticking to it. It's easy to get caught up in the magic and overspend on souvenirs and snacks, but having a set budget can help prevent any post-trip regret. Additionally, he recommends bringing your own snacks and drinks to the parks to avoid shelling out money for expensive meals.

Another pro tip from Ryan is to take advantage of FastPass+ and plan your ride schedule accordingly. This allows you to skip the long lines and maximize your time in the parks. And for those looking for a more budget-friendly accommodation option, Ryan suggests staying off-site at a nearby hotel or rental property.
